Output be8bb18ed1c765c9a1e68a2375168140bf051845f8187b480847269122506526:58

value
12479966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d153af530980a92a9d0fd44d67aeb8897170f3e OP_EQUAL
address
38ibPRS5WHQZc7DsfzaNuuS44jjbgLcWiQ
transaction
be8bb18ed1c765c9a1e68a2375168140bf051845f8187b480847269122506526
spent
true